MAPUSA: Shiv Sena Goa desk in-charge Sanjay Raut in his interaction with the media said that the party will contest 22 to 25 seats in the Assembly elections and would not form alliance with any other party.
“We are targeting 22 to 25 seats in Goa. During the 2017 Assembly elections, we had an alliance with Maharashtrawadi Gomantak Party (MGP) and Goa Surksha Manch. However this time, we have decided to fight independently,” Raut said.
“We have not seen such an unsuccessful government in the history of Goa. If given an opportunity, Goans are ready to send this government back home even before the elections,” said Raut.
